Probably a bit high on Dermott and low on Muzzin as a ufaI like what Dubas have done so far, but this is terryfing. All our defencemen except for Reilly have their contracts running out at the end of 2019/2020 season. Barrie and Dermott will both demand big pay raise and Muzzin will probably deserve some raise too.
Barrie - 2.75M -> 8-9M
Dermott - 0.86M -> 3.5-4.5M
Muzzin - 4.0M -> 4.5-5.5M
That's a rise from 7.6M to 16-19M. There's no way we'll be able to afford them without a trade including one of our higher-paid forwards.
